BYD PH launches its newest family car, the Tang DM-i

For your household’s daily commute or fun-filled road trip

The BYD Tang was first introduced to us in 2024 through the BYD Tang pure electric version. It gave us a proper seven-seat SUV with a spacious, luxurious, and sleek design—with a pure EV driving range of 530km, which is great for traveling to closer regions.

Now, BYD Car Philippines has released the all-new BYD Tang DM-i, which aims to be the Filipino family hybrid SUV. With an increased range that is better than that of its EV counterpart, the Tang DM-i has a premium feel and intelligent safety features. Managing director Bob Palanca states that the Tang DM-i is the biggest SUV unit in their lineup and hints at more of the brand’s future expansion into the Super DM-i technology.

Under the hood, it utilizes BYD’s Super DM-i technology that combines a 21.5kWh Blade battery with a turbocharged onboard generator, bringing its total to 267hp and 315Nm of torque. Within 7.5 seconds, this SUV can achieve 0-100km/h while still ensuring both safety and power.

In terms of charging efficiency, the car can charge from 15% to 100% in three hours using AC power. Meanwhile, via DC charging, the vehicle can charge from 30% to 80% in 22 minutes.

The Vehicle-to-Load (V2L) function transforms the SUV into your power outlet for your devices, especially beneficial during power outages, long-distance travel, or even when you just want to camp in a nearby city.

This being a hybrid SUV, it has a combined driving range of over 1,000km, which suits out-of-town vacations with less range anxiety, almost doubling the distance of the Tang pure EV. If you want to utilize its pure EV driving mode, it can reach 110km in one charge, which is great for short distances and city driving. Whether you’re bringing your child to school, or going to work, or heading off to that weekend getaway, the Tang DM-i has you covered.

Inside, the Tang DM-i has seven spacious seats, providing a comfortable legroom. Its gray interiors and sleek modern design highlight the usage of high-quality materials. The advanced infotainment system has a wide 15.6-inch touchscreen alongside the sonorous 12-speaker Dynaudio sound system.

Priced at ₱2,098,000, the Tang DM-i has three colors: Moonstone Gray, Pearl White, and Silver Sand Black.

If you’re considering buying an electrified vehicle, this car is not a bad choice.
